Q: Why did my canary deploy get auto-blocked?

A: Probably the Perchline gating rules. Canaries are held if error rate rises 2% over baseline, p95 latency doubles, or the rollout touches a frozen service. Reviewers: don't approve overrides casually — check the gate report first. If you genuinely need to force-promote, the override console asks for the on-call recovery passphrase, which is listed below.

unlock words, yawig-kagef: gordor-holvan-ulaael-pramir-ulaiel-tamdor

# Artifact Signing — Receipt Mailer

Scope: donation-receipt mailer (givepost-mailer) for the Lanternfen nonprofit stack. All artifacts are signed in CI before publish; unsigned builds are rejected at the Moorcote gateway. Review checklist: confirm the pipeline signs the tarball, not the container layer; confirm verification runs pre-deploy; confirm rotation notes are current. Do not approve PRs that bypass the verify step. Verification must use the active signing identity, which is recorded below.

release key, fajef-kajeg: bky19_LdLu6Ne6FLi8he2c24d

### Step 4: Point the EXIF Scrubber at the New Store

After verifying that the Lanternmoor scrub workers have drained their queues, update the scrubber's persistence target. The `metadata_removals` table must be migrated first, since workers write audit rows synchronously and will fail closed otherwise. Confirm row counts match between old and new stores before cutover. Once validated, configure the workers to use the following.

replica DSN, kajep-yahag: mssql://praok_svc:iF@db-8d68.plorvaio.local:5432/eliion